Ultimate Van Camper Top Guide: Best Picks for 2024

A van camper top transforms a standard van into a compact, weather-resistant shelter for overnight adventures without permanent modifications. These tops integrate seamlessly with existing windows and doors, providing a practical base for road trips, festival travel, and dispersed camping.

Compared with rooftop tents and full conversions, camper tops balance protection, visibility, and setup speed at a moderate price point. This article outlines what to expect when choosing, installing, and living in a van camper top, supported by specifications, comparisons, and real-world questions.

Preparing Your Van for a Camper Top

Start by confirming your van model and roof profile match the top's rail system. Most modern camper tops use crossbars or factory rails, which distribute weight and reduce stress on the roof panel.

Measure door clearances, window positions, and any roof vents before ordering. Reinforce weak points with factory-recommended accessories, and test fit the empty unit on level ground to verify alignment and airflow before adding gear.

Installation and Weatherproofing

Step-by-Step Mounting

Follow the manufacturer's sequence for clamps, gaskets, and rails, tightening to specified torque values. Use stainless steel fasteners designed for vehicle use to minimize corrosion and fatigue.

Seal all contact surfaces with high-quality butyl tape and inspect it annually. Check drainage channels around doors and vents to prevent pooling that could leak into living areas.

Living Comforts and Storage Solutions

Interior Layouts

Many models include a raised rear platform for sleeping, with storage underneath accessed by hatches. Position heavy items low to maintain a stable center of gravity on uneven terrain.

Add lightweight dividers, modular bins, and magnetic hooks to keep gear organized without drilling into the van walls. Consider a removable foam mattress that doubles as seating during the day.

Safety, Maintenance, and Upgrades

Durability Considerations

Inspect seams, zippers, and hinges after each season for wear. Clean fabric with pH-neutral soap, avoid harsh solvents, and store the top loosely in a dry place during prolonged inactivity.

Upgrade with integrated shades, reflective roof coating, or additional locks to improve security and temperature control on long routes. Replace worn weatherstripping promptly to preserve insulation and waterproofing.

FAQ

Reader questions

How much weight can a van camper top safely support?

Most models are tested for 75–100 kg of live load when properly distributed. Verify the manufacturer's rating and avoid concentrated loads at rails or attachment points to protect the van's structure.

Can I install a camper top myself without specialized tools?

Yes, with a helper and basic hand tools, many users complete installation in under an hour. Double-check alignment, torque specs, and sealant placement to prevent rattles and leaks over time.

Will extreme cold or heat damage the materials?

Modern fabrics and coatings handle wide temperature swings, but prolonged UV exposure can fade and weaken seams. Use reflective covers in hot climates and avoid sharp ice removal on panels in freezing conditions.

Are camper tops compatible with roof boxes and bike carriers?

Yes, most designs accommodate crossbar-mounted accessories, but check spacing and load paths. Distribute added weight evenly and lower the center of gravity by placing rooftop gear closer to the cab.
